I was never terribly impressed with the M16 family as a fun shooter but I do admire the purity of it's design. Recently I read that it's perfectly legal to fabricate a firearm for personal use, and that you can buy 80% finished, non-serialized receiver blanks and complete the machining yourself. I run a machine shop, so finishing the work would be no prob. Long story short, I decided that it's cheaper to buy a legal, transferable AR lower than to DIY. In fact, there's something of a cottage industry doing exactly this.
